Aspire Heritage School Bags 39 Medals at Srinagar Taekwondo Championship

   

SRINAGAR: Aspire Heritage School delivered a standout performance at the 4th District Srinagar Taekwondo Championship, securing a total of 39 medals in a highly competitive event held at the Indoor Sports Complex Srinagar.

The two-day championship, conducted on April 15–16, witnessed participation from 26 schools and over 300 students across the district. Aspire Heritage School clinched 17 gold, 13 silver, and 9 bronze medals, marking one of the strongest showings in the tournament.

The medal ceremony was held on April 18, where the winning students were felicitated for their achievements.

Organisers said the championship aimed to promote physical fitness, discipline, and mental resilience among students. The school’s performance highlights its emphasis on integrating sports with academics as part of holistic education.

Officials noted that such events play a key role in encouraging youth participation in sports and fostering teamwork, confidence, and competitive spirit among students.
